#cc203e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#cc203e is composed of 80% red, 12.5% green and 24.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 84.3% magenta, 69.6%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 349.5 degrees, a saturation of 72.9% and a lightness of 46.3%. #cc203e color hex could be obtained by blending #ff407c with #990000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

#cc203e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#cc203e has RGB values of R:204, G:32, B:62 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.84, Y:0.7,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 13377598.
